+ # returns confusion matrix as array, predicted values are in rows
+ # example:
+ # [[nil,"active","moderate","inactive"],["active",1,3,99],["moderate",4,2,8],["inactive",3,8,6]]
+ # -> 99 inactive compounds have been predicted as active
+ def confusion_matrix
+ raise "no classification statistics, probably a regression valdiation" unless @metadata[OT.classificationStatistics]
+ matrix = @metadata[OT.classificationStatistics][OT.confusionMatrix][OT.confusionMatrixCell]
+ values = matrix.collect{|cell| cell[OT.confusionMatrixPredicted]}.uniq
+ table = [[nil]+values]
+ values.each do |c|
+ table << [c]
+ values.each do |r|
+ matrix.each do |cell|
+ if cell[OT.confusionMatrixPredicted]==c and cell[OT.confusionMatrixActual]==r
+ table[-1] << cell[OT.confusionMatrixValue].to_f
+ break
+ end
+ end
+ end
+ end
+ table
+ end
+
+ # returns probability-distribution for a given prediction
+ # it takes all predictions into account that have a confidence value that is >= confidence and that have the same predicted value
+ # (minimum 12 predictions with the hightest confidence are selected (even if the confidence is lower than the given param)
+ #
+ # @param [Float] confidence value (between 0 and 1)
+ # @param [String] predicted value
+ # @param [String,optional] subjectid
+ # @return [Hash] see example
+ #
+ # Example 1:
+ # validation.probabilities(0.3,"active")
+ # -> {:min_confidence=>0.32, :num_predictions=>20, :probs=>{"active"=>0.7, "moderate"=>0.25 "inactive"=>0.05}}
+ # there have been 20 "active" predictions with confidence >= 0.3, 70 percent of them beeing correct
+ #
+ # Example 2:
+ # validation.probabilities(0.8,"active")
+ # -> {:min_confidence=>0.45, :num_predictions=>12, :probs=>{"active"=>0.9, "moderate"=>0.1 "inactive"=>0}}
+ # the given confidence value was to high (i.e. <12 predictions with confidence value >= 0.8)
+ # the top 12 "active" predictions have a min_confidence of 0.45, 90 percent of them beeing correct
+ #
+ def probabilities( confidence, prediction, subjectid=nil )
+ YAML.load(OpenTox::RestClientWrapper.get(@uri+"/probabilities?prediction="+prediction.to_s+"&confidence="+confidence.to_s,nil,
+ {:subjectid => subjectid, :accept => "application/x-yaml"}))
+ end
